Skip site navigation (1)Skip section navigation (2)
Date:      Thu, 9 Nov 2006 13:51:01 +0300
From:      Ruslan Ermilov <ru@FreeBSD.org>
To:        Takahashi Yoshihiro <nyan@FreeBSD.org>
Cc:        cvs-src@FreeBSD.org, src-committers@FreeBSD.org, cvs-all@FreeBSD.org
Subject:   Re: cvs commit: src/sys/boot/pc98/libpc98 biossmap.c
Message-ID:  <20061109105101.GA53554@rambler-co.ru>
In-Reply-To: <200611090828.kA98S3ms026878@repoman.freebsd.org>
References:  <200611090828.kA98S3ms026878@repoman.freebsd.org>

next in thread | previous in thread | raw e-mail | index | archive | help

--Bn2rw/3z4jIqBvZU
Content-Type: multipart/mixed; boundary="sm4nu43k4a2Rpi4c"
Content-Disposition: inline


--sm4nu43k4a2Rpi4c
Content-Type: text/plain; charset=us-ascii
Content-Disposition: inline
Content-Transfer-Encoding: quoted-printable

On Thu, Nov 09, 2006 at 08:28:02AM +0000, Takahashi Yoshihiro wrote:
> nyan        2006-11-09 08:28:02 UTC
>=20
>   FreeBSD src repository
>=20
>   Added files:
>     sys/boot/pc98/libpc98 biossmap.c=20
>   Log:
>   Add a stub of bios_addsmapdata().  PC98 does not have BIOS SMAP.
>  =20
>   Revision  Changes    Path
>   1.1       +38 -0     src/sys/boot/pc98/libpc98/biossmap.c (new)
>=20
How about removing this and committing an attached patch instead?


Cheers,
--=20
Ruslan Ermilov
ru@FreeBSD.org
FreeBSD committer

--sm4nu43k4a2Rpi4c
Content-Type: text/plain; charset=us-ascii
Content-Disposition: attachment; filename=p
Content-Transfer-Encoding: quoted-printable

Index: i386/libi386/bootinfo32.c
=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=
=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=
=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D
RCS file: /home/ncvs/src/sys/boot/i386/libi386/bootinfo32.c,v
retrieving revision 1.37
diff -u -p -r1.37 bootinfo32.c
--- i386/libi386/bootinfo32.c	2 Nov 2006 01:23:17 -0000	1.37
+++ i386/libi386/bootinfo32.c	9 Nov 2006 10:41:52 -0000
@@ -219,7 +219,9 @@ bi_load32(char *args, int *howtop, int *
     file_addmetadata(kfp, MODINFOMD_HOWTO, sizeof howto, &howto);
     file_addmetadata(kfp, MODINFOMD_ENVP, sizeof envp, &envp);
     file_addmetadata(kfp, MODINFOMD_KERNEND, sizeof kernend, &kernend);
+#ifndef PC98
     bios_addsmapdata(kfp);
+#endif
=20
     /* Figure out the size and location of the metadata */
     *modulep =3D addr;
Index: pc98/libpc98/Makefile
=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=
=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=
=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D
RCS file: /home/ncvs/src/sys/boot/pc98/libpc98/Makefile,v
retrieving revision 1.24
diff -u -p -r1.24 Makefile
--- pc98/libpc98/Makefile	11 Apr 2006 20:11:30 -0000	1.24
+++ pc98/libpc98/Makefile	9 Nov 2006 10:41:18 -0000
@@ -5,11 +5,13 @@ INTERNALLIB=3D
=20
 .PATH:	${.CURDIR}/../../i386/libi386
=20
-SRCS=3D	bioscd.c biosdisk.c biosmem.c biospnp.c biospci.c biossmap.c \
+SRCS=3D	bioscd.c biosdisk.c biosmem.c biospnp.c biospci.c \
 	bootinfo.c bootinfo32.c comconsole.c devicename.c elf32_freebsd.c \
 	i386_copy.c i386_module.c nullconsole.c pxe.c pxetramp.s \
 	time.c vidconsole.c
=20
+CFLAGS+=3D	-DPC98
+
 BOOT_COMCONSOLE_PORT?=3D 0x238
 CFLAGS+=3D	-DCOMPORT=3D${BOOT_COMCONSOLE_PORT}
=20

--sm4nu43k4a2Rpi4c--

--Bn2rw/3z4jIqBvZU
Content-Type: application/pgp-signature
Content-Disposition: inline

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.5 (FreeBSD)

iD8DBQFFUwgVqRfpzJluFF4RAkiCAJ4hXi7ol/vjEcIi7sD/sRXoA509KQCghAMw
cS3/bD/QTSSALKN4sKxtWHE=
=01Ok
-----END PGP SIGNATURE-----

--Bn2rw/3z4jIqBvZU--



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?20061109105101.GA53554>